+Important Changes
+
+The internal counters that track which "era" (range of years) we are in
+rolls over every 136 years'.  The current "era" started at the stroke of
+midnight on 1 Jan 1900, and ends just before the stroke of midnight on
+1 Jan 2036.
+In the past, we have used the "midpoint" of the  range to decide which
+era we were in.  Given the longevity of some products, it became clear
+that it would be more functional to "look back" less, and "look forward"
+more.  We now compile a timestamp into the ntpd executable and when we
+get a timestamp we us the "built-on" to tell us what era we are in.
+This check "looks back" 10 years, and "looks forward" 126 years.
